perf(producer): cache transfer-converted hdr image buffers per render job (#384)
## Summary Add `HdrImageTransferCache` — a per-render-job bounded LRU keyed by `(imageId, targetTransfer)` — so static HDR image layers whose source transfer differs from the render's effective transfer (PQ↔HLG) are converted **once per job** instead of **once per composited frame**. ## Why `Chunk 8B` of `plans/hdr-followups.md`. `blitHdrImageLayer` was running `Buffer.from` + `convertTransfer` on every composited frame, even though the converted buffer is identical for the entire job. For a multi-second comp at 30 fps this is hundreds of redundant transfer conversions on the hot path. ## What changed - New `packages/producer/src/services/hdrImageTransferCache.ts` — bounded LRU keyed by `(imageId, targetTransfer)` that owns the converted HDR rgb48 buffer for static HDR image layers: - Same-transfer requests return the source buffer untouched (zero copy). - Cross-transfer requests pay one `Buffer.from` + `convertTransfer` on first miss, reuse the cached copy on every subsequent frame. - Wired into `renderOrchestrator.ts` via `HdrCompositeContext.hdrImageTransferCache`, instantiated once per render job, and consumed by `blitHdrImageLayer` on both the main composite path and the transition path. ## Test plan - [x] `packages/producer/src/services/hdrImageTransferCache.test.ts` — 12 tests: - hit/miss semantics - distinct keys per image and per target transfer - LRU eviction + promotion - `maxEntries=0` passthrough - source-buffer immutability for cached entries - invalid options - [x] Re-ran the Chunk 8A HDR benchmark — for the `hdr-regression` fixture (which has cross-transfer image layers) the cache hits 100% after the first frame; for HDR fixtures without cross-transfer images the same-transfer passthrough is a no-op. ## Stack Chunk 8B of `plans/hdr-followups.md`. Sits on top of Chunk 8C (logger gating) and Chunk 8A (benchmark harness) so the win is measurable.
